Read MoreA simple scoring system can predict the chances of children with a respiratory tract infection being admitted to hospital, thereby helping to target antibiotics more appropriately. This important finding is highlighted in a commentary written by Chris Winchester, Managing Director of Oxford PharmaGenesis, and colleagues, which is published today in Lancet Respiratory Medicine.
